Unveiling the Secrets Below: Cutting-Edge Underground Detection

Technological advancements are constantly pushing the boundaries of what we can discover about our world. This is particularly true when it comes to exploring the mysteries that lie hidden beneath the surface. Advanced underground detection technology is now allowing unprecedented insights into the subterranean world, shaping various fields including archaeology, geology, and even infrastructure.

One of the most significant developments in this field is the use of ground penetrating radar (GPR). This non-invasive technique uses radio waves to generate images of objects buried below the surface. GPR has proven incredibly useful in a wide range of applications, from locating buried structures, pinpointing ancient artifacts, and even analyzing the integrity of underground infrastructure.

Your Guide to the Subsurface: Reliable Underground Infrastructure Locators

Before you dig, knowing what's below is crucial. Underground infrastructure like pipes, cables, and utilities pose serious risks if unexpectedly damaged. That's where reliable underground locators come in. These advanced tools help you identify these hidden assets with accuracy, ensuring protection during excavation projects.

There are various types of locators available, each designed for different applications. Electromagnetic locators are commonly used to detect metallic pipes, while GPR (Ground Penetrating Radar) can reveal both metallic and non-metallic installations. Choosing the right locator depends on your specific needs and the type of infrastructure you're working with.
